Formula for speed = EJ22 block, 2.5l open-deck heads (COBB's stage 3 are magnificent), STOCK internals, T25 or T3/T4 tubro, STi trans, axles, driveshaft, and diff.

All being equal, a Legacy turbo is an out-of-the box quickie and has a superb motor in it allready.
